Friar Tucks Restaurant

Friar Tucks is not a posh, fancy restaurant and they don't claim to be, but what you'll get from this quintessential Carmel neighborhood diner is a good hearty home-style meal and friendly service. Don't be surprised if Greg or Cynthia, the owners of Friar Tucks, attentively checks to see if your meal was prepared properly and ends up sitting down at your table engaging in a friendly conversation. Open every day for lunch and dinner. Just in case you're a fan of the thick fluffy pancakes like me, Friar Tuck's serves the thinner Swedish style pancakes.  I prefer to eat there for lunch where the prices are very reasonable for Carmel.  They call their burgers the "3 napkin variety" because they are seriously big and juicy.  My favorite is the Guacamole Bacon cheeseburger for $6.50 served with fries or a salad.  Yummy!!!
